Output e82e020dcaa748c7601a879a8adc0252cdfb5d51db39b7e9962a3d9b8692890b:155

value
1456884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8808c9dbc09e3d5602ce4e714d80cbe57b2b64c OP_EQUAL
address
DQsrVTKBNtCQeFAtWmmWUnz245UpZFGLSc
transaction
e82e020dcaa748c7601a879a8adc0252cdfb5d51db39b7e9962a3d9b8692890b
spent
true